Output e136890240e36f65f19dece326a1b9224188afb87b9574589390b5bdb9b7aedb:1

value
1515501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ba0fafb0f93b9bed50a32cef51d0f49f7d38e3 OP_EQUAL
address
34mM7dy1Kye9grufNqaGDCZWo38BWFoqrS
transaction
e136890240e36f65f19dece326a1b9224188afb87b9574589390b5bdb9b7aedb
spent
true